Warner Bros. Interactive has announced the Mortal Kombat Season Pass for the Xbox 360. The 1200 Microsoft Point purchase will give all owners access to all four upcoming DLC characters.

Each DLC character will be available separately for 400 Microsoft Points, meaning Season Pass holders save 400 Microsoft Points. The pass launches on June 21, alongside the first DLC character, Skarlet. Kenshi, Rain and a yet to be announced character will follow.
